1. Wander Through Unique Markets

London is home to a variety of markets, each with its own flavour. Explore:
  • Camden Market – where alternative fashion meets international street food.
  • Borough Market – a paradise for food lovers with a plethora of gourmet delights.
  • Portobello Road Market – the best place for antiques and vintage treasures.


2. Experience London’s Art Scene

Immerse yourself in contemporary and historical art. Some notable spots include:
  • Tate Modern – a free museum housing a vast collection of modern art.
  • Street Art in Shoreditch – explore the colourful murals and graffiti.
  • Saatchi Gallery – known for showcasing new contemporary art.


3. Unique Dining Experiences

Break away from conventional dining with quirky options:
  • Dinner in the Sky – enjoy gourmet food suspended high above the ground.
  • The Cheese Bar – indulge in a cheese feast at this dedicated venue.
  • Sketch – an eccentric restaurant with themed dining rooms and afternoon tea.


4. Engage with Nature

London's parks and gardens provide serene experiences unlike any other. Consider:
  • Kew Gardens – explore breathtaking floral displays and historic landscapes.
  • Hampstead Heath – enjoy stunning views of the London skyline.
  • St. James's Park – perfect for a leisurely stroll with a backdrop of Buckingham Palace.


5. Dive into History

Transport yourself to a different era with these historical activities:
  • Visit the Tower of London to see the Crown Jewels and learn about its dark history.
  • The British Museum houses treasures from around the world, including the Rosetta Stone.
  • Shakespeare’s Globe Theatre for an authentic Elizabethan theatre experience.


6. Thrilling Adventures

For those seeking a rush, explore options that pump your adrenaline:
  • The London Eye – a ride that offers stunning views from 135 metres above.
  • Go Ape – a treetop adventure course that tests your courage.
  • Escape Rooms – tackle puzzles with friends in themed rooms around the city.


7. Unique Workshops

Explore your creative side with engaging workshops throughout London:
  • Pottery workshops in the heart of Camden.
  • Cooking classes, focusing on international cuisines.
  • Photography classes that explore London’s vibrant scenes.


8. Unusual tours

Think beyond the standard tourist routes. Consider exploring:
  • A Jack the Ripper walking tour – delve into the chilling mysteries of Whitechapel.
  • A Harry Potter walking tour – find film locations and learn behind-the-scenes secrets.
  • A London Ghost Tour – explore the haunted sites of the capital.


9. Seasonal Activities

No matter the time of year, London has something unique to offer:
  • Summer pop-up cinemas showcasing classic films.
  • Winter wonderland festivities in Hyde Park, complete with ice skating and festive food.
  • Spring flower shows at iconic gardens like Kew.


10. Captivating Performances

Experience London’s rich theatrical scene:
  • Attend a West End musical – a dazzling spectacle is guaranteed!
  • Explore small theatre productions for something a little different.
  • Street performances at Southbank Centre, offering a variety of acts.


11. Indulgent Relaxation

Sometimes, a day out needs to be about unwinding:
  • Spa days at luxury venues like the Corinthia Hotel.
  • Afternoon tea at The Ritz for an iconic London experience.
  • Outdoor yoga in one of London’s beautiful parks.


12. Uncover Hidden Gems

Take a step off the beaten path to discover:
  • The Seven Noses of Soho – a quirky art installation scattered throughout Soho.
  • The Hunterian Museum – a fascinating collection of medical specimens.
  • Little Venice – a picturesque canal area that feels worlds away from the city.
